It is well made with a solid wood frame and deck to house the mattress. The four little finials that decorate the post gives it that cozy vintage type feel.The sides and back boards are solid wood with wooden slats and it fits a twin mattress (only one mattress came with the bed you'll have to buy the one for ...
...is that it's a trundle bed.The roll out trundle, which appears to be a clothes drawer from the outside can be used for storage or you can place a twin mattress in it. I have a mattress in mine. I wanted to know why it was called trundle so I looked in the dictionary and this is what I found: a trundle is a small wheel or roller, a low wheeled cart-a dolly. Hence the name trundle bed. I received my new Sealy bed about 6 weeks ago. I suffer from a bad back - so having read the reviews on the bed which has twice as many springs for extra support as a normal bed I was convinced this would only improve my nights sleep. i was right. The sealy bed is very comfortable - with a layer of memory foam on the top, this may sound odd but its also a very warm bed. It tends to hold body heat which if you're always cold like me is a bonus. Mine ...
...its a double bed, the storage available within the four drawers is very handy and out of sight. The bed is light and easy to assemble. The only thing I had to get used to is it stands higher off the ground than my previous bed. So at first it seemed like I was having to climb into it - but you get used to this after a while.
